Elegant Of Spirit, Male Tabaxi [Permalink]
Personal [hide]
Description: This late middle aged man is wearing a long, violet, dusty cloak and is in decent physical shape. His gray fur is thinning but still full. He wears crescent spectacles with a black brim.
Personality: He has a good heart but also a terrible temper. He will forgive often but not before yelling and berating someone for whatever they have done wrong. He has a hair trigger and will fly into rage over the tiniest perceived slights.
History: When he was but 6 years old his parents immigrated from the east. He was one of the best in his class, and was picked up by his current employer. He quickly showed his capability and was soon promoted to a head role. He struck the Fletcher job and began his own company from there.
Motivation: Sabotage a competitor; and he has passion for adventuring and risk
Flaws: Antagonistic. Bonds: Immigrant, Job, Adventurer. Occupation: Fletcher
Voice: Shortens vowels

Frug Tarkelby, Male Gnome [Permalink]
Personal [hide]
Description: He is a small man, but exceptionally fit. He wears a fancy green suit. With a patchy chestnut beard and wild chestnut hair. His face is covered beneath a completely black helmet.
Personality: He has two modes he varies between. On the job he is cold, steely and emotionless. Off the job he is a party animal. He is vehemently anti-magic. All of it is evil and corrupting in his opinion.
History: From birth he was tutored by a cruel and relentless mentor. He couldn't stand his childhood mentor and eventually formed a pact with his mentor's previously failed apprentice to rebel. When their plan failed the mentor lashed out against both of them and fled. He became a Mason soon after.
Motivation: Sabotage a competitor; and wants to work out more often
Ideals: Athletic, Opinionated. Bonds: Attractive, Job, Mentor. Occupation: Mason
Voice: Puts emphasis on the wrong words

Adrik Ironfist, Male Dwarf [Permalink]
Personal [hide]
Description: His left thumb is blackened and bruised, but otherwise he appears quite healthy. He dresses well, typically a more casual-formal manner. He sports a flattop hair cut. His face is covered beneath a completely black helmet.
Personality: He is cool and collected. He likes to make quips and puns whenever he does anything. He also makes a point to compliment his superiors and flatter them. He spends most of his days drinking in the Inn, the rowdiest and most dangerous establishment in town. There he gambles, wrestles and listens to stories told by travelers.
History: Born to a pair of adventurers, Adrik grew up listening to his father's many stories. While he appears to be a normal Dwarf, he's... not quite right. Perhaps he's slightly insane, or otherwise so mentally alien to the rest of the world that he plain doesn't fit in. He is untrained/undisciplined, which makes him dangerous.
Motivation: Obtaining odd cultural Dwarven artifacts is his passion; and he desires power and/or immortality
Ideals: Disciplined. Flaws: Insane. Bonds: Attractive, Adventurer. Occupation: Map Maker
Voice: Deep voice with rolling R's

Gunter Oakley, Male Human [Permalink]
Personal [hide]
Description: He has a missing right leg. He wears very tight pants and wife beaters, though occasionally he sports a tan coat. He wears a broad hat to hide his balding. His voice is smooth and creepy, always level, but somehow just slightly unnerving.
Personality: He is almost excessively polite to everyone, even when angry. More though he will beg to come along on any journeys. He will attempt to stowaway on any ship he can in the hopes that it will get him further away.
History: Trained by his father for as long as he can remember he had it drilled in his head that it was his duty to serve his country. His father was a soldier and died while he was still young. Gunter was left his father's suit of armor and trained in its use and care. He is untrained/undisciplined, which makes him dangerous.
Motivation: He wants nothing more than to rejoin the army.
Flaws: Insane, Shy. Bonds: Slave, Military. Occupation: Servant
Voice: Australian accent
